What is Alkaline Water?
Alkalinity and pH are related but not the same thing – they measure different properties of water.
pH measures how acidic or basic the water is on a scale of 0 to 14. Below 7 is acidic, 7 is neutral, and above 7 is alkaline.
Alkalinity measures water’s capacity to neutralize acids-how much “buffering power” the water has. Alkaline water is controlled mainly by alkaline minerals in the water.
